> David,
>
> I have had problems on some workstations, where, for example, I
> wanted to "play" a Shift-F6 into a CHOOSE ... CHKBOX command so
> that everything would be preselected. Sometimes it would not work.
> Usually it would
>
> On a hunch that it had something to do with timing, I added a couple of
> keystrokes to the beginning of the playback file that, in effect, would be
> keypresses that would have little or no effect on the screen during a
> choose command. If either or both of those keystrokes got lost or
> ignored, it would make no difference. Since adding those, the
> CHOOSE has always come up with all choices pre-selected. I think I
> just pressed a few space bars before pressing the Shift-F6.
